Output 904521363ce6b3917aea2f09833b963f7d635fdf75f48fbf08e66c3abdc009af:22

value
2953188
script pubkey
OP_0 OP_PUSHBYTES_20 cf0129870f64542240b51da89278d19724458b8f
address
bc1qeuqjnpc0v32zys94rk5fy7x3jujytzu0y3pv2w
transaction
904521363ce6b3917aea2f09833b963f7d635fdf75f48fbf08e66c3abdc009af
spent
false

16 Sat Ranges